全方位站长技能、SEO优化学习平台
当前位置:网站首页 > Zblog笔记 > 正文

zblog文章页面调用摘要文字(去除HTML代码的纯文字)

作者:admin发布时间:2023-08-09分类:Zblog笔记浏览:205评论:0


温馨提示:手机扫码可阅读当前文章!
文章简介:Zblogphp的文章调用摘要文字功能在主题制作中经常使用,特别是在Zblog博客模板中更为重要。然而,Zblogphp提供的默认调用代码无法控制摘要字数。因此,我们需要自己来解决这个问题。首先,在include.php文件中添加以下代码:...

Zblogphp的文章调用摘要文字功能在主题制作中经常使用,特别是在Zblog博客模板中更为重要。然而,Zblogphp提供的默认调用代码无法控制摘要字数。因此,我们需要自己来解决这个问题。


首先,在include.php文件中添加以下代码:


function zblogphp_get_excerpt($as, $type, $length, $ellipsis) {
    global $zbp;
    $excerpt = '';
    
    if ($type == '0') {
        $excerpt = trim(SubStrUTF8(TransferHTML($as->Intro, '[nohtml]'), $length)) . $ellipsis;
    } else {
        $excerpt = trim(SubStrUTF8(TransferHTML($as->Content, '[nohtml]'), $length)) . $ellipsis;
    }
    
    return $excerpt;
}


请注意,在第一行的`zblogphp_get_excerpt`是一个模板应用ID,你可以根据自己的需要进行修改。


接下来,我们可以在文章列表中进行调用。调用的方式如下:


{zblogphp_get_excerpt($article, 1, 80, '...')}


其中,`$article`代表当前文章对象,`1`表示调用正文内容,`80`表示摘要字数,`'...'`表示省略号等其他内容。

欢迎您,来自美国的朋友,您的IP:3.143.22.217,您的网络:Amazon_EC2服务器


欢迎 发表评论:

  • 请填写验证码

服务热线

1888888888

要发发发发发发

站长微信公众号

站长微信公众号

分享:

支付宝

微信